Quinoa: ancient Peruvian superfood

Quinoa is an ancestral grain from the high Andean zones of South America cultivated in South America for 5000 years.

Its consumption has been spreading internationally thanks to its high nutritional value – quinoa delivers 10 amino acids essential for humans, it has 40% more lysine than milk and it provides high content of proteins as well as minerals.

Peru is currently the world’s leading producer and exporter of quinoa. The main producing regions are located in the center and south of the country.
